Located in the Croatian town of Senj, on the hill Nehaj, is the Nehaj Fortress. The Croatian phrase -- Ne hajati, which meaning -- do not care, is where the name Nehaj originates. The Uskok people gave this name to the hill and the fortress, which they constructed as a defensive stronghold atop the hill.
